PETALING JAYA: Kenanga Research remains “neutral” on the seaport and logistics sector’s prospects, as the Red Sea conflict continues to disrupt Asia-Europe trade.
Roughly a third of global container volume comes from the Asia-Europe route, but the prolonged conflict in the Middle East, with no immediate sign of the Red Sea tensions de-escalating, is weighing down on the Asia-Europe trade, the research house said.
